Abstract
An example apparatus places translaminar screws across a facet joint between adjacent first and second vertebrae in a minimally invasive surgical procedure. The apparatus includes a first K-wire, a second K-wire, a first fixation block, a second fixation block, a support block, a first rod member, a second rod member, and a cannula. The first K-wire is inserted into the spinous process of the first vertebrae. The second K-wire is inserted into a transverse process of the second vertebrae. The first fixation block has perpendicularly extending first and second passages. The first K-wire extends into the first passage in the first fixation block. The second fixation block has perpendicularly extending first and second passages. The second K-wire extends into the first passage in the second fixation block. The support block has perpendicularly extending first and second passages. The first K-wire extends into the first passage in the support block. The first rod member extends through the second passage in the first fixation block and the second passage in the second fixation block. The second rod member further secures the first and second fixation blocks to the first and second vertebrae. The second rod member extends through the second passage in the support block. The cannula enables implantation of the translaminar screws across a facet joint between the first and second vertebrae.
